Off Road Vehicle Operating (4×4) – LANTRA Awards

This Off Road Vehicle Operating (4×4) LANTRA Awards Training Course is designed for anyone:

  • Operating an off road vehicle in an off road environment; typically, 4×4 vehicles but possibly 6×4, 6×6 vehicles etc.
  • Wishing to update their skills in off road vehicle operating (4×4) and/or satisfy health and safety legislation regarding the safe use of 4×4 off road vehicle operating at work.

Off Road Vehicle Operating (4×4)  – Certification Options:

Two certificate options have been designed to support operators with off road vehicle operating (4×4) safely for work related purposes.
The course will take place using suitable off road areas.

Certificate option 1: Principles of Off Road Vehicle Operating is designed for users of 4x4s who will only tackle basic off road obstacles and will always avoid more severe threats and weather conditions. Assessment is on a limited range of obstacles with a lower threshold of acceptable threat/risk.

Certificate option 2: Operating Vehicles in Off Road Adverse Conditions is designed for users of 4x4s who may seek to tackle some more severe obstacles and sometimes in poor weather conditions. Assessment is over a range of obstacles, identifying and managing risks in a practical manner making reasonable use of vehicular and driver capabilities as appropriate

Training Objectives:

At the end of this course the learner will be able to:

  • Comply with legal requirements and safe practice
  • Identify risks associated with off road vehicle use
  • Select and use app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E)
  • Understand the main causes of accidents
  • Identify the controls, systems and components of the vehicle
  • Perform pre-start checks
  • Identify and report faults
  • Prepare the vehicle for use off road
  • Assess the suitability of the ground/route
  • Make structured decisions about if and how to tackle obstacles
  • Perform a failed hill climb
  • Drive over a variety of terrain
  • Perform an on-site risk assessment
  • Identify the loading/towing capacities
  • Understand legal and practical requirements for travelling on a public road
  • Identify the dangers of vehicle recovery/self-recovery
  • Demonstrate decision making skills based on considering the attributes of:
    • the obstacle/situation
    • the vehicle
    • the driver.

Course Sessions:

  • Introduction
  • Health and safety
  • Attributes of vehicles and systems
  • Attributes of obstacles
  • Attributes of operators
  • Vehicle checks and preparation
  • Basic operating techniques
  • Vehicle recovery, safety briefing
  • Off Road to on road checks

Duration:

  1. Principles of Off Road Vehicle Operating = 1 Day
  2. Operating Vehicles in Off Road Adverse Conditions = 2 Days

Max Number of Learners:

3 (Instructor:Learner 1:3, Vehicle:Learner 1:3)
